30 Second Briefing
Aggreko has signed a minimum 15‑year power purchase agreement with Harmony Gold to build and operate what is described as Australia’s largest off‑grid renewable hybrid power facility for the Eva copper project in northwest Queensland. The build‑own‑operate arrangement will combine on‑site renewables with thermal generation and battery storage to supply continuous power to the remote open‑pit operation. For mine planners and process engineers, the long‑term PPA locks in a dedicated low‑emission power source, influencing pit expansion options, processing throughput and future electrification of mobile fleets.
Technical Brief
- Contract term is explicitly “minimum 15 years”, allowing long‑horizon mine planning around a fixed power solution.
- Facility is described as Australia’s largest off‑grid renewable hybrid plant, indicating multi‑tens of megawatts scale.
- Hybrid configuration integrates on‑site renewables, thermal generation and battery energy storage for grid‑quality power in islanded mode.
- Remote northwest Queensland location necessitates full electrical islanding, with no reliance on the National Electricity Market.
Our Take
In our database, Harmony’s Eva copper project in Queensland appears repeatedly alongside major contracts to Thiess and Metso, signalling that the Aggreko offtake-style power deal is part of a coordinated build-out of mine, plant and energy infrastructure rather than a standalone sustainability gesture.
Aggreko’s recent commentary on fuel price volatility in African mining, also in our coverage, underlines that the Eva copper power purchase agreement in Australia fits a broader commercial push by the company to replace diesel-exposed generation with hybrid systems at remote copper and gold operations.
